Introduction to LED Diodes with LM-80 Reports
LED (Light Emitting Diode) technology has revolutionized the lighting industry, offering energy-efficient, durable, and versatile lighting solutions. As the technology has evolved, the need for standardized testing and reporting has become increasingly important. This is where LM-80 reports come into play. LM-80 is a standard developed by the National Electrical Manufacturers Association (NEMA) that specifies the testing and reporting procedures for LED light sources.

The Testing Process
The LM-80 testing process involves several steps to ensure accurate and reliable results:
1. Selection of Test Conditions: The testing conditions, including temperature, humidity, and current, are determined based on the intended application of the LED device. This ensures that the results are relevant to real-world usage.
2. Data Collection: The LED device is subjected to the specified test conditions for a predetermined period, typically 6,000 hours. During this time, the device's performance parameters are continuously monitored and recorded.
3. Data Analysis: The collected data is analyzed to determine the performance characteristics of the LED device. This includes evaluating the lumens output, color temperature, and CRI, as well as assessing the device's longevity.
4. Reporting: The results of the testing are compiled into an LM-80 report, which includes detailed information about the test conditions, data collection, and analysis. This report is then submitted to the relevant regulatory authorities or used for marketing purposes.
